
Today we’d like to introduce you to Keri Burns.
Hi Keri, so excited to have you on the platform. So, before we get into questions about your work life, maybe you can bring our readers up to speed on your story and how you got to where you are today.
I earned a Bachelor’s Degree in Business in 2001, never actually realizing that it could lead me to owning my own business someday. When my husband Jerry and I started our family in 2004, I searched for something that could allow me to contribute in a meaningful way, while also having the flexibility I felt I needed to raise young children. In 2005, I began working in the Cosmetology Industry as a Licensed Manicurist. After several years in the business, I decided to also earn a license as an Esthetician. After practicing as a service provider for 16 years and two children who are off to college soon, we took a leap of faith and purchased a unique salon & day spa with full liquor license (two businesses in one). Although we had lived and worked in Midland for all of those years, this opportunity brought me back to my roots in Genessee County. In the last two years, we have worked with an incredible staff of 25 in developing our vision for this business. We are so fortunate to be part of such a lovely community, and we look forward to many more years.

Great, so let’s talk business. Can you tell our readers more about what you do and what you think sets you apart from others?
We are a Salon & Day Spa with a full liquor license, beer garden, and boutique. We are located in a historic building in the heart of downtown Linden. We offer services from hair, nails, and lashes to skincare, massage, and body treatments. Our staff is passionate about providing quality service in a warm and friendly environment, and we are known for our talented professionals, outstanding professional product lines, and clean environment. With our 10 pedicure stations, 7 spa treatment rooms, and 2 couples suites, we love serving parties and hosting events. Last but not least, our guests love that we have a bar and beer garden right on site! The area’s only “Wine Spa and Day Bar,” The Waiting Room, is open any time the spa is open. No need for an appointment at the spa to come in and enjoy a cocktail.
